I am trying to monitor traffic utilization on VLAN using SNMP. When I look at the SNMP walk, the counters for the VLANs are showing zero across the board. I've searched through the forum and found server cases of the issue, but no actual fix or even response from an employee.
Is this still a known issue with PowerConnect switches?
My Switch is a PowerConnect 2848.
What I'm getting back from SNMP:
